Bhurban Accord (also known as the Murree Declaration) was signed on:
8 March 2008
6 March 2008
7 March 2008
10 Mach 2008
Bhurban Accord (also known as the Murree Declaration) was a political agreement signed by two of Pakistan’s biggest political powers, the Pakistan Peoples Party (PPP) and the Pakistan Muslim League (Nawaz) (PML-N) and was signed by co-chairman of the PPP Asif Ali Zardari and PML-N leader Nawaz Sharif it was signed on 8 March 2008 in PC Bhurban in the province of Punjab. The Bhurban Accord had one primary goal. The deposed judges, sacked under President of Pakistan Pervez Musharraf when he imposed emergency rule within the country on 3 November 2007, are to be reinstated within 30 days of the new coalition government.

Second General Elections in Pakistan were held on:
6 March 1977
7 March 1976
7 March 1978
7 March 1977
General elections were held in Pakistan on 7 March 1977 to elect 200 members of the National Assembly. These were the second general elections held in Pakistan and the first to be held after the Bangladesh Liberation War, which saw East Pakistan break away to become an independent state of Bangladesh.
